RESPEC is looking to support its data infrastructure, reporting needs, and budgeting processes by hiring a SQL Server Data Engineer who can translate business needs into technical solutions and ensure data accuracy, integrity, and security.
Requirements
- Proven experience with SQL Server (T-SQL, stored procedures, performance tuning).
- Strong knowledge of SSRS report development and deployment.
- Familiarity with large and complex databases, including performance optimization and data modeling.
- Experience with OLAP cubes or multidimensional data models.
- Experience with ETL tools or data integration platforms.
- Familiarity with Excel-based reporting and pivot-tables.
- Understanding of financial concepts and budgeting workflows.
Responsibilities
- Develop, maintain, and optimize SQL Server databases and queries.
- Design, develop, and deploy reports using SQL Server Reporting Services (SSRS).
- Ensure data accuracy, integrity, and security across systems.
- Troubleshoot and resolve data/reporting issues in a timely manner.
- Document processes and provide user support for reporting tools.
- Collaborate with finance and operations teams to support budgeting and forecasting processes.
- Act as a consultant to internal stakeholders, translating business needs into technical solutions.
